Abstract

fetched live from OpenAlex

Conventional proportional integral (PI) controllers are the most, commonly, known and used techniques in grid-connected photovoltaic (PV) applications. Indeed, PI-based controllers are, practically, easy to design and implement. Moreover, they provide good performance, i.e., high-quality output signals, in steady-state conditions. Nevertheless, these controllers are, mainly, designed for the control of linear systems. Therefore, when implemented with non-linear systems, they suffer from slow dynamic response. Accordingly, in this paper, a non-linear and advanced PI-based controller is proposed. The proposed controller consists of an auto-tuned PI-based controller using artificial neural network (ANN). The main objective is to enhance the dynamic response of the DClink inductor current in grid-connected PV current source inverter (CSI) and to ensure that the injected grid current is equal to that generated by the DC-bus, which implies that the entire power provided by PV generator is injected into the grid. A numerical simulation model of the grid-connected PV system, i.e., CSI, PI-controller, and MPPT algorithm, is realized using Simulink and PLECS environments to validate the accuracy of the proposed solutions. The numerical results prove that the ANN auto-tuned PI-based controller leads to superior dynamic response of the DC-link inductor current and better-quality of the injected grid current compared to the conventional PI-based controller.
